Best Time & Best Days to Visit

Timing is everything when planning a visit to Purple Martini. To truly appreciate what this venue has to offer, arriving around 4:30 PM to 5:00 PM is essential. This allows you to settle into a good spot, order your first round of drinks, and watch the entire progression of the sunset, which is the venue's primary draw. The transition from daylight to dusk is the most magical window of time at Sunset Point.

In terms of days, the experience varies significantly:

  • Weekdays (Monday to Thursday): These days offer a more relaxed and intimate vibe. It is easier to secure a front-row table, and the service is generally faster. It is the perfect time for couples or those looking for a peaceful sunset experience without the intense weekend crowds.
  • Weekends (Friday to Sunday): This is when Purple Martini is at its most energetic. The venue is usually packed, the music is louder, and the "party" atmosphere is in full swing. If you enjoy a high-energy crowd and want to see the venue in its full glory, the weekend is for you. However, booking a table is mandatory during these days.
  • Seasonal Considerations: The peak season in Goa (November to February) offers the best weather—cool breezes and clear skies. The monsoon season (June to September) provides a different kind of beauty, with dramatic clouds and a stormy sea, though outdoor seating may be limited depending on the rain. The "shoulder seasons" of October and March/April are also excellent, offering a balance of good weather and manageable crowds.

Entry Fee, Cover Charges & Table Booking

Purple Martini generally operates on a cover charge or minimum spend basis, especially during peak hours and weekends. The entry fee can vary depending on the season, the day of the week, and whether there is a special event or celebrity DJ performing. Typically, the cover charge is fully redeemable against food and drinks, making it a fair deal for those planning to spend the evening there.

Table booking is highly recommended, if not essential, for the sunset hours. The "Front Row" tables, which offer an uninterrupted view of the sea, are the most sought-after and often come with a higher minimum spend requirement. You can usually book via their official website, social media handles, or by calling their reservation desk directly. For large groups or VIP bookings, it is advisable to reach out at least a few days in advance, especially during the December peak season when North Goa is at its busiest.

If you are a walk-in guest, arriving early (before 4:30 PM) gives you the best chance of securing a seat. However, be prepared to wait or stand at the bar area if the seated sections are full. The management is generally quite efficient at handling the flow of guests, but the popularity of the venue means it reaches capacity quickly almost every single day.

Dress Code & Club Rules

While Goa is generally known for its laid-back attire, Purple Martini maintains a Smart Casual / Resort Wear dress code. This isn't the place for gym wear or overly tattered beach clothes. Think stylish linen shirts, summer dresses, elegant sandals, and well-tailored shorts. Looking the part adds to the overall sophisticated vibe of the venue and makes for better photos!

In terms of club rules, the management maintains a strict policy to ensure the safety and comfort of all guests:

  • Age Restriction: Like most premium bars in Goa, entry is typically restricted to those above the legal drinking age (21 or 25 depending on current local regulations). Carry a valid ID.
  • Behavior: There is a zero-tolerance policy for unruly behavior, harassment, or illegal substances. The security team is professional but firm.
  • Outside Food/Drinks: Strictly prohibited.
  • Pets: While some Goan shacks are pet-friendly, it is best to check with Purple Martini in advance, as their policy can change based on the crowd density and event type.
  • Smoking: Smoking is usually permitted in designated outdoor areas, but be mindful of fellow guests, especially in the seated dining sections.

Location & How to Reach Purple Martini Goa

Purple Martini is located at Sunset Point, St. Anthony's Vaddo, Anjuna, Goa. Its location is one of its greatest assets, perched on the northern end of Anjuna Beach, right where the coastline curves and provides a wide-angle view of the sea.

How to Reach:

  • By Scooter/Bike: The most popular way to reach is by renting a scooter or a "Pilot" (motorcycle taxi). The roads leading to Anjuna can be narrow and winding, so drive carefully, especially at night. There is designated parking near the entrance, though it can get crowded.
  • By Car/Taxi: Taxis are readily available from all major parts of Goa (Calangute, Baga, Vagator, Panjim). If you are driving your own car, be aware that parking in Anjuna can be a challenge during peak hours, so arrive early. Using a taxi is often the better option if you plan on enjoying the extensive cocktail menu.
  • On Foot: If you are staying in the Anjuna beach area, you can walk along the beach or the cliffside path to reach the venue. It’s a scenic walk, especially during the late afternoon.

Landmarks: Look for the signs for "Sunset Point" or "Anjuna Flea Market." Purple Martini is a well-known landmark, and any local or taxi driver will know exactly where to take you. It is situated near other famous spots like Guru Bar and Shore Bar, making it easy to find.

Safety Tips & Visitor Guidelines

To ensure you have the best possible experience, keep these safety tips and guidelines in mind:

  • Don't Drink and Drive: Goan roads are narrow, often poorly lit, and can be dangerous at night. Use the local taxi services or apps like GoaMiles.
  • Watch the Cliffs: While the venue is secure, the surrounding cliff areas can be slippery and steep. Stick to the designated paths and don't venture too close to the edge for photos after consuming alcohol.
  • Stay Hydrated: The Goan humidity can be intense. Balance your cocktails with plenty of water to avoid dehydration.
  • Respect the Locals: Anjuna is a residential area as much as it is a tourist hub. Be mindful of noise levels when leaving the venue late at night.
  • Secure Your Belongings: While the venue is safe, it is always wise to keep an eye on your bags and phones, especially when the crowd gets thick during the night.
  • Check the Bill: It is standard practice to review your bill before payment. Ensure that the cover charge has been correctly adjusted if applicable.
